Job Overview We are seeking a motivated and detail-oriented Financial Analyst I to support financial planning, reporting, and analysis across the global business. Within the FP&A team this role will work closely with Finance leadership and Operational teams to deliver accurate reporting, support forecasting processes, and provide data-driven insights to inform business decisions. This role will support exposure to AI and machine learning initiatives. This is an entry-level role designed for candidates looking to build a strong foundation in financial planning and analysis. Responsibilities Support the monthly financial reporting process, including preparation of management reports and dashboards Assist in budgeting and forecasting cycles, including data collection and model updates Assist with preparation of charts, graphs, and reports as required Perform variance analysis (actual vs. budget/forecast) and provide key insights Consolidate and validate data from multiple systems to ensure accuracy and consistency Provides technology-driven data insights for Finance and Operational teams key decision-making Develop and maintain Excel-based models and analysis tools Support ad hoc analysis and strategic initiatives Identify opportunities to improve reporting process automation and data quality through the use of AI tools Requirements and Qualifications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ting, or related field 0–2 years of relevant experience (internship experience acceptable) Strong proficiency in Microsoft Excel (formulas, pivot tables, data analysis) Basic understanding of financial statements and key metrics Strong analytical, organizational, and problem-solving skills 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ment Strong communication skills and attention to detail Preferred Exposure to financial planning, budgeting, or reporting Experience with financial systems or data tools (e.g., Power BI, ERP systems) Interest in FP&A, partnering with Operations, and financial strategy AI tools and machine learning exposure #LI-BD1 Please note that the salary range provided is a good faith estimate for the position at the time of posting and not a guarantee of compensation.
